The first thing that hits you is an impersonal space that strongly smells of food. However, the children wanted to stay and eat. The food came in abundance, but the avocado deluxe sandwich tasted too much of garlic, and the French toast was a half loaf that had absorbed the flavor of the wooden bowl it was served in. Small fruit flies were buzzing around the place; it didn't help that we killed three, they kept coming. One of the staff was super friendly and accommodating, but unfortunately, the overall rating based on the food and the venue means we won't be coming back. There are cozier places with significantly higher quality food.
